How We Work
1
Emergency Call
Your urgent call to Damage Restoration Company Akron activates our rapid response. We gather critical details about the water damage, dispatching a certified team immediately. Our goal is to arrive quickly.
2
On-Site Assessment
Upon arrival, our Akron technicians perform a thorough inspection, utilizing moisture meters and thermal imaging to precisely locate all affected areas. This comprehensive assessment informs our detailed action plan.
3
Water Extraction & Drying
We deploy industrial-grade pumps and powerful extractors to remove standing water efficiently. High-capacity air movers and dehumidifiers then dry the structure, preventing secondary damage and mold growth.
4
Cleaning & Sanitization
All affected surfaces and contents undergo meticulous cleaning, sanitization, and deodorization. We use EPA-approved antimicrobial agents to inhibit mold and bacterial growth, ensuring a safe environment.
5
Restoration & Repair
Our skilled team rebuilds and repairs damaged structural elements. This final phase restores your property to its pre-damage condition, completing the restoration process with quality craftsmanship.

Sewage Water Removal vs. DIY: When to Call a Pro

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ill (less than 10 gallons) Yes No Easy to clean up and don't need specialized equipment or training.
Large water spill (over 100 gallons) No Yes Needs specialized equipment and training to safely and efficiently clean up the spill.
Sewage water backup in a high-traffic area No Yes Needs specialized equipment and training to safely and efficiently clean up the spill and prevent further damage.

Sewage Water Removal Cost in Mentor, OH

The cost of sewage water removal in Mentor, OH, will depend on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Sewage water removal $500 - $2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ions.
Drying and cleaning $200 - $1,000 Size of affected area, type of materials, and equipment needed.
Restoration and repair $1,000 - $5,000 Scope of work, materials needed, and labor costs.
